Why is Sacramento airport called SMF?
It actually stands for Sacramento Metropolitan Field. No one has called it that since 1998, when Sacramento Metropolitan Airport transformed into Sacramento International Airport, but the three-letter code remains the same.

Terminal B has 20 gates labelled B4-B23. It is served by Aeromexico, Alaska, Boutique, Contour, Frontier, Hawaiian, Horizon, JetBlue, Southwest, Spirit, Sun Country, and Volaris. It houses on level 1 the baggage claim area, on level 2 the ticketing area with check-in counters, and on level 3 some food & drink and retail concessions. Levels 1, 2 & 3 are in the pre-security area. High-tech exit lanes were installed recently reducing operational costs. It is connected to both the Hourly B carpark and the A& B parking garage.

Is SMF a domestic airport?
SMF is primarily a domestic airport, with non-stop flights to just 3 international destinations in Mexico. Still, the airport is in the middle of a 20-year expansion plan that may allow destinations such as Tokyo, London, and Frankfurt to be added to the list in the near future. Table of contents.

Sacramento International Airport ( IATA: SMF, ICAO: KSMF, FAA LID: SMF) is 10.5 miles (16.9 km) northwest of downtown Sacramento, the capital of the state, in Sacramento County, California, United States. It serves the Greater Sacramento Area, and it is run by the Sacramento County Airport System.
What is the name of the airport in Sacramento?
Sacramento International Airport (SMF) opened October 21, 1967 as Sacramento Metropolitan Airport (the airfield itself was Sacramento Metropolitan Field), with one 8600-foot runway. The initial runway was on the west side of the airfeild, and is now named to the headings of 17R/35L. Previously, air service to Sacramento was handled by Sacramento Municipal Airport (SAC), now Known as Sacramento Executive Airport. Sacramento Metropolitan was the first purpose-built public-use airport west of the Mississippi when it opened in 1967. All airports under the Sacramento County Airport System (previously the Sacramento County Department of Airports), including SMF, are self-supporting through user fees and rentals. No local, state, or federal tax funds are used for operating costs.

How much solar power does Sacramento International Airport use?
In January 2018, Sacramento International Airport's solar array was commissioned; it is rated at 7.9 MW and will supply around 30% of the airport's electricity needs. The electricity will be purchased by NRG Energy for an agreed period of 25 years. The project was built by Borrego Solar using LG solar panels at a cost of $15 million. The solar power costs 7 cents per kWh as opposed to 9 cents, so the airport expects to save nearly $1 million annually.
How many passengers did Sacramento Airport serve in 2014?
On April 23, 2015, the airport announced that it had posted twelve consecutive months of improved passenger traffic that started in April 2014, and 8.9 million passengers were served in 2014. Passenger growth continued in 2015 and 2016, with 9.6 million passengers served in 2015 and 10.1 million in 2016. In 2017, the airport surpassed its 2007 high of 10.7 million passengers, with 10.9 million passengers.
